If you're interested, I programmed (by accident, I swear) an interactive map to show you where most of our pets are from. Click on the names below the map image.

Interactive Pet (or Flash) Map

When I said by accident, I meant it. My initial concept was to slap an image on the stage and plot some points but (a) that's boring, and (b) the map will probably be too large to squeeze all the pets on it. Somehow, my brain started turning and even though I didn't pay a whole lot of attention in Math class, formulas started formulating in my head. I had the thing working with the ability to hop from point to point, but I also wanted the ability to zoom in and out, so as soon as I introduced that added variable I had to scrap all my programming and start over. After a few more days of programming, I created an overkill'er map.

I'll expand on this mini-project but I don't know hot yet. For starters, my Flash application (or "engine") can:
  • Use any large or even huge map image on a small web-friendly stage
  • Pan and Zoom in and out at the same time
  • Predefine an array of points/coordinates
  • Add coordinates or locations on the fly
If I pull the map and all the image elements out of the Flash, and throw the entire configuration in to XML like my video player, it will be nothing short of awesome.
